Cadillac-Funk meets Classic Underground Boom-Bap when MC’s Small World (RIP) and Sand Man drop their conscious street prose.
This highly slept on album is produced by DJ Trevy Trev (Trevor Williams) who while working as an A&R Rep signed the Wu-Tang Clan to LOUD Records which made it possible for the label to become one of the most successful and respected Rap Record Labels of it’s time.
